Abstract
The present investigation was carried out by using 20 synchronized pregnant
Nellore Brown ewes and documented normal intrauterine development of fetus using
transabdominal ultrasonography. The EVD, CRL, BPD, ONL and PL were measured
between days 22-64; 29-64: 43-113; 43-113 and 43-141 during gestation respectively and
obtained high significant correlation (p<0.05) between GA and EVD (r= 0.9497; R2 =
0.902), CRL (r=0.9573; R2 = 0.916), BPD (r=0.9687; R2 = 0.938), ONL (r = 0.9873; R2
= 0.974) and moderate correlation for PL (r = 0.6850; R2 =0.470) between days 43 - 78 of
gestation. The regression equations, y = 5.319x + 18.09; y = 3.808x + 27.23; y = 15.94x
+ 28.43; y = 9.471x + 25.66; y = 11.87x + 34.13 were computed between GA and EVD,
CRL, BPD, ONL and PL (up to 78 days), respectively where y is gestational age in days
and x is the ultrasonic parameter in centimetres. The regression equations generated were
validated in the field, 30 and 100 per cent of ewes delivered within ± 7 and ± 14 days of
expected parturition dates for EVD, 55.5 and 100 per cent of ewes delivered within ± 7
and ± 12 days for CRL, 61.9 and 71.4 per cent of ewes delivered within ± 7 and ± 14
days for BPD, 58.3, and 100 per cent of ewes delivered within ± 3 and ± 11 days for
ONL and for placentome length 62 and 100 per cent of ewes, in first half of gestation,
delivered within ±7 and ±14 days of expected parturition dates, respectively. It could be
concluded that the fetal parameters studied in the present study were well correlated and
validated with gestational age except the placentome length. Further research is required
to define the significance of equations in the field conditions.
